Product Rivals

Compared to similar lithium-ion battery packs like those from Milwaukee or Makita, the DEWALT DCBP034-2 stands out for its compact size and power density. Milwaukee batteries are known for ruggedness but tend to be bulkier, which can be a downside in confined workspaces. Makita packs offer great runtime but sometimes lack the quick recharge speed of the POWERSTACK technology. The LED charge indicator on the DEWALT batteries also gives them a usability edge. However, if cost is your primary concern, some alternatives might be cheaper upfront but won’t deliver the same longevity or power. Each brand has its strengths, but for me, this pack strikes the best balance for demanding jobs.
